Radeon HD 5830 vs Radeon HD 7750 Technical Specifications
Side-by-side specs, architecture details, clocks, memory, power, and platform differences.

Radeon HD 5830
The Radeon HD 5830 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in February 25 2010. It features the TeraScale 2 architecture. The core clock speed is 800 MHz. It has 1120 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 175W. Manufactured using 40 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 1,726 points.

Radeon HD 7750
The Radeon HD 7750 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in February 15 2012. It features the GCN 1.0 architecture. The boost clock speed is 800 MHz. It has 512 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 55W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 1,703 points. Launch price was $109.
Graphics Performance
The Radeon HD 5830 scores 1,726 and the Radeon HD 7750 reaches 1,703 in the G3D Mark benchmark — just a 1.4% difference, making them near-identical in rasterization performance. The Radeon HD 5830 is built on TeraScale 2 while the Radeon HD 7750 uses GCN 1.0, both on 40 nm vs 28 nm. Shader units: 1,120 (Radeon HD 5830) vs 512 (Radeon HD 7750). Raw compute: 1.792 TFLOPS (Radeon HD 5830) vs 0.8192 TFLOPS (Radeon HD 7750).

Video Memory (VRAM)
The Radeon HD 5830 has 1 GB of VRAM, while the Radeon HD 7750 carries 4 GB. Radeon HD 7750 gives you 300% more memory capacity, which matters more once you move into heavier textures, mods, or higher resolutions. Memory bandwidth: 128 GB/s (Radeon HD 5830) vs 72 GB/s (Radeon HD 7750) — a 77.8% advantage for the Radeon HD 5830. Memory bus width is 256-bit on the Radeon HD 5830 and 128-bit on the Radeon HD 7750. L2 Cache: 512 KB (Radeon HD 5830) vs 256 KB (Radeon HD 7750) — the Radeon HD 5830 has significantly larger on-die cache to reduce VRAM reliance.

Power & Dimensions
The Radeon HD 5830 draws 175W versus the Radeon HD 7750's 55W — a 104.3% difference. The Radeon HD 7750 is more power-efficient. Recommended PSU: 500W (Radeon HD 5830) vs 300W (Radeon HD 7750). Power connectors: 2x 6-pin vs None. Card length: 280mm vs 168mm, occupying 2 vs 1 slots.

Value Analysis
At launch, the Radeon HD 5830 came in at $239, while the Radeon HD 7750 launched at $109. On MSRP, Radeon HD 7750 was 54.4% cheaper ($130 less). Performance per dollar on MSRP (G3D Mark / MSRP): 7.2 (Radeon HD 5830) vs 15.6 (Radeon HD 7750) — the Radeon HD 7750 offers 116.7% better value. The newer card here is Radeon HD 7750 (2012 vs 2010).
